Oil Slick Contaminates Shidvar Island's Pristine Ecosystem

An oil slick has reached Shidvar Island, a protected wildlife sanctuary in Iran. Videos depict various wildlife, including birds, turtles, and crabs, trapped in tar. The incident raises concerns about environmental damage in this pristine area.

An oil slick has recently reached Shidvar Island, a protected wildlife sanctuary located in the Persian Gulf. This island is renowned for its turquoise waters and white sand beaches, making it a significant ecological site. The contamination poses a serious threat to the diverse wildlife that inhabits the area, including various species of birds, turtles, and crabs.

Videos emerging from the region show distressing scenes of wildlife trapped in mounds of tar. The images depict birds struggling to free themselves, as well as turtles and crabs ensnared in the sticky substance. Such visuals highlight the immediate impact of the oil slick on the island's ecosystem and the urgent need for intervention.

Shidvar Island is not only a natural treasure but also a vital habitat for many species. The sanctuary is known for its rich biodiversity, which is now at risk due to the oil contamination.
